Strategic planning for development of tourism capabilities in Urban areas Case study: city of Orumieh

Orumieh city as the provincial center, which is neighborhood with three countries and also due to having the second largest saltwater lake in the world, has a valuable natural,  historical and ethno-cultural potentials in tourism field. The main goal of this study, is that by using strategic planning approach, while indicating the available  potentials of orumieh city, it is tried to provide adequate and appropriate strategies and identify strategies to promote tourism for the residents' enjoyment from the tourism activity. In this article, firstly, for developing the components,  30 experts and technicians in urban affairs and tourism of Orumieh city were surveyed by using Delphi questionnaire and the list of internal and external factors  required for strategic planning was prepared,
 
then by using field surveying method, the view of three groups including  tourists, host residents and authorities about tourism , deficiencies and needs, were evaluated, in form  of questionnaire method. To determine the sample size of tourists and host residents, Cochran sample size formula was used  and about the authorities group, due to their small population of the statistical society,  all of them were surveyed.  .Cronbachs' alpha statistical test  for  questioner of tourists' group, host  residents and authorities (0/89 , 0/90, 0/74 respectively) showed that this  research has satisfactory validity and reliability. At the next step, to analyze the data and provide tourism  development strategies,  SWOT analysis pattern was used. And to determine relative weight of the components , a combination of the  opinions of the three participants have been used.  The final results indicate that  the  acceptable strategies  in tourism planning of this city at the first priority is aggressive strategy(SO), and the diversification strategy(ST)  and  revised strategy ( WO)  have  the next  priority in planning. Finally QSPM matrix was formed for each group of the strategies and prioritization  of the strategies for the tourism development in orumieh city, have been presented in three groups.
